It is natural and understandable that the Unofficial members
should have wished to have such a debate at this time. The debate
was a procedural one. What the Unofficial members were seeking, through the motion, was simply an opportunity to discuss any proposals for the future of Hong Kong, in the Council before any final agreement is reached. That is a reasonable wish. Although it is too early to say precisely how Hong Kong opinion will be consulted on any arrangements proposed for the future, many bodies 25 including LEGCO can be expected to make their views known.

DESIRE OF HONG KONG PEOPLE FOR MORE INFORMATION ABOUT THE TALKS
8. We fully understand the desire of Hong Kong people to have more information about the talks. But this must be balanced
.
against our conviction that progress can best be made in confid-
ential negotiations. To the extent that we can do so without prejudicing the confidentiality upon which the British and
32 Chinese governments are agreed, we seek to explain to Parliament and to Hong Kong opinion what our general objectives are. In due course, there will of course be an opportunity for Hong Kong
